DILLARD HIGH SCHOOL PARTNER APPRECIATION BREAKFAST AND NETWORKING – On Tuesday, June 2, 2015, Dillard High School held a breakfast and networking event for over 50 of its partners in education. Dennis Wright, president of 100 Black Men of Greater Fort Lauderdale, accepted a certificate of appreciation award from Principal Casandra D. Robinson. Joe Raio, senior technical evangelist, Microsoft Corporation, also accepted a certificate of appreciation award from Principal Robinson
